Market Environment

Definition ∞ The market environment describes the prevailing conditions and factors influencing the trading, valuation, and sentiment within financial markets, including those for digital assets. This encompasses macroeconomic indicators, regulatory developments, technological advancements, and investor behavior. It shapes the opportunities and risks faced by participants in the cryptocurrency and blockchain sectors. It is a comprehensive view of market dynamics.
